연구실 소개
최성열 교수의 연구실은 원자력 시설의 폐기 단계에서 발생하는 방사성 에어로졸과 CRUD(부식 관련 미상 침전물)의 거동을 중심으로 핵심 안전성 문제를 해소하기 위한 기초 및 응용 연구를 수행하고 있습니다. 특히, 방사성 에어로졸의 입자 크기 분포, 열전달 및 유동 메커니즘, 고온 환경에서의 정밀 분석 기술 개발에 중점을 두고 있으며, 핵심 기술로는 레이저 유도 분광법(LIBS) 기반의 실시간 원소 분석과 고성능 필터링 시스템 평가를 포함합니다. 이는 핵발전소 폐기 및 유지보수 과정에서의 작업자 안전과 환경 보호를 위한 핵심 기술 기반입니다.

Simulating the Corrosion-Related Unidentified Deposit (CRUD) on the surface of fuel assemblies is necessary to predict the axial offset anomaly and the localized corrosion induced by the CRUD during the operation of nuclear power plants. A new CRUD model was developed to predict the formation of the CRUD deposits, considering the deposition and erosion mechanisms. The rapid expansion of nuclear energy in China has intensified concerns regarding spent fuel management. However, the consequences of failure or delay in developing approaches to managing spent fuel in China have not yet been explicitly analyzed. Thus, a dynamic analysis of transitions in nuclear fuel cycles in China to 2050 was conducted. An advanced nuclear reactor based on molten salts including a molten salt reactor and pyroprocessing needs a sensitive monitoring system suitable for operation in harsh environments with limited access. Multi-element detection is challenging with the conventional technologies that are compatible with the in-situ operation; hence laser-induced breakdown spectroscopy (LIBS) has been investigated as a potential alternative.
